Gr.1 performer returns to form at Ballarat today

 
6 Oct 2015

Tavistock four-year-old mare Imperial Lass (ex Tricia Ann, by Zabeel) resumed on a winning note today at Ballarat, winning a Benchmark78 over 1600 metres in the hands of Linda Meech.


Trained by Peter Moody, Imperial Lass was having her first start since finishing third in the Queensland Oaks-Gr.1 (2200m) behind Winx at the end of May.


The Oaks placing was one of two black type placings last season for Imperial Lass, the other effort being a third in the MRC Ethereal Stakes-LR (2000m) around this time last year.


From the first crop of Tavistock, Imperial Lass was bred, raised and sold by Cambridge Stud.  Peter Moody went to $125,000 to secure her at the 2013 New Zealand Bloodstock Karaka Premier Sale.
